A colleague of mine has pointed out that to post to Google Groups, he must give his mobile phone number to Google to send an SMS or to call him so that he can create a Google account. Are there any alternatives? Thanks. -- You received this message because you are subscribed to the Google Groups "Puppet Users" group.
